Vegetarian Lasagna
In theory, this vegetarian lasagna recipe fits into the theme of 'simplicity' that I try to maintain for this site. However, the actually assembly of the lasagna might get a little messy if this is your first time. The ingredients, as it is here are pretty basic, but feel free to include additional herbs and spices as per your preference.
There are many variations of vegetarian lasagna, this one is pretty much fully vegan (depending on the noodles and spaghetti sauce that you choose). Several other variations call for the use of soy cheese or other dairy substitutes. I do not have that much experience with these cheeses, but I know that people's opinions on them are mixed. The texture is the biggest difference that people complain about, as the analog can never be 100% the same as the dairy. Luckily, in this example, we will be using tofu, which just happens to make an excellent alternative to ricotta or cottage cheese.
Ingredients
16-ounce pack of lasagna noodles (check the ingredients, you can find egg-free noodles) 2 28-ounce jars of spaghetti sauce(again, check ingredients for meat, and milk products) 10-ounce frozen chopped spinach(optional) 1 pound tofu, medium 1 tsp oregano 1 tsp parsley 1/2 tsp basil dash of garlic powder
1.Preheat oven at 350°F (175°C)
2. Drain tofu but do not squeeze out all of the excess water. Mix thoroughly with all of the spices. Ideally, you want to use a food processor here, but it is possible to do this with your hands...just be thorough. The tofu should have the consistency of ricotta cheese, if it is too thick then add some soy milk.
3.Begin assembly in medium-sized pan. Start with one cup of spaghetti sauce. Cover with one layer of uncooked noodles. Add another cup of sauce and top it off with another noodle layer.
4.Add 1/2 tofu mixture, spread evenly. Add 1/2 of the spinach on top of this. Then one more cup of sauce and finally, a layer of noodles.
5.Repeat step 3 adding remaining tofu and spinach. Finish by adding remaining sauce over the last layer of noodles. Make sure that the noodles are fully covered with sauce.
6. Bake for 40 minutes, covered. Uncover and bake for an additional 20 minutes.
